The Grace House Adult Day Program is seeking a compassionate, dependable, and energetic Caregiver/Program Assistant to support older adults in a safe, engaging, and welcoming environment. The ideal candidate is passionate about serving seniors, promoting independence, and helping participants enjoy meaningful daily experiences. Responsibilities Assist participants with daily activities and engagement programs. Provide companionship and emotional support to participants. Help facilitate recreational activities, games, music therapy, and group discussions. Assist with meal and snack service. Monitor participant well-being and report concerns to supervisors. Encourage social interaction and participation in scheduled activities. Maintain a clean, safe, and welcoming environment. Assist with participant check-in and check-out procedures. Support special events, outings, and family engagement activities. Follow all program policies and procedures regarding participant care and safety. Qualifications High school diploma or GED preferred. Experience working with seniors, individuals with disabilities, or in a caregiving role preferred. Strong communication and interpersonal skills. Ability to work independently and as part of a team. Compassionate, patient, and dependable. CPR/First Aid certification preferred (or willingness to obtain). Ability to pass a background check. Desired Qualities Positive attitude and professional demeanor. Genuine passion for serving older adults. Strong organizational and time-management skills. Ability to create a warm and engaging atmosphere for participants and their families. Must be able to lift, transfer, push, or pull up to 50 lbs with or without reasonable accommodations.
